Vancouver, British Columbia, Canada Remote (Country) Full-time

Atimi is hiring a Backend Developer - Java, SQL, AWS

About the Role

Atimi is seeking an experienced Java Backend Developer for a fully remote position within Canada. You will be a proactive contributor within project teams, helping to guide development through the entire lifecycle while ensuring high standards for code quality, architecture, and DevOps practices.

What You'll Do

  • Collaborate proactively within the project team to guide the product through the entire development lifecycle.
  • Ensure code quality and governance, and that engineers follow established patterns and designs.
  • Plan, estimate, and contribute to architecture, coding, and development.
  • Refactor and continuously improve the codebases.
  • Communicate technical decisions thoroughly to the global team.
  • Take responsibility for releases and contribute to the ongoing support of live applications.
  • Get involved with deployment and operation of software (DevOps).
  • Deliver fair outcomes for customers and maintain a high level of professional conduct.

What We're Looking For

  • 6+ years of strong Java development experience.
  • 2+ years of experience with data cleansing and extraction for ETL processes.
  • 2+ years of experience with Amazon Redshift.
  • 2+ years of experience with AWS Step Functions and Lambda.
  • 4+ years of experience with the AWS cloud environment.
  • 3+ years of experience with both SQL and NoSQL databases.
  • Experience using and/or configuring CI/CD pipelines.
  • Experience building scalable software services (e.g., serverless, microservices).
  • Strong Object-Oriented Design skills and knowledge of design principles, patterns, and best practices.
  • Experience working directly with clients and stakeholders to define and refine requirements.
  • Strong written and verbal English skills.

Nice to Have

  • Python experience.
  • Experience with Domain-Driven Design (DDD).
  • Experience with Test-Driven Development (TDD).

Technical Stack

  • Java, SQL, NoSQL
  • Amazon Redshift, AWS Lambda, AWS Step Functions, AWS

Benefits & Compensation

  • Salary range: $108k - $158k per annum.
  • Flexible schedule and generous time off.
  • Option to work from home.
  • Team-building activities and online company events.
  • Generous compensation and benefits package.

Work Mode

This is a fully remote position open to candidates located within Canada.

Atimi is an equal opportunity employer.

Required Skills
JavaSQLNoSQLAmazon RedshiftAWS LambdaAWS Step FunctionsAWSBackend DevelopmentData ProcessingSystem DesignAPI DevelopmentCloud ArchitectureDistributed Systems
Ready to relocate and code from paradise?

Thailand or Vietnam — your office, your rules

Iglu offers relocation to Bangkok, Chiang Mai, Ho Chi Minh City, or Hong Kong. Full employment, legal setup, and a community of 200+ digital professionals.

Relocation to 5 countries
Full legal work setup
Developer community access
Work-life balance culture
Explore locations
Relocation support included
About company
Atimi

Atimi works with high-profile and Fortune 500 companies to extend their brand reach by providing high-quality software solutions that integrate mobile and web experiences. Over 60% of their apps have been featured by Apple.

Visit website
Job Details
Category backend
Posted 8 months ago